## Deploying the Gatewick Proctor Queue

Deploys are pretty painless: push to main, wait for the pipeline, then watch the queue drain dashboard for five minutes. If candidates pile up mid-exam, roll back first and ask questions later — the queue replays safely. Everything the workers care about lives in one config block, shown here for reference.

settings of bafof-yagef:
JOROX_PIN=8740
JOROX_TENANT=pelox
JOROX_METRICS_HOST=metrics.jorox.qorvelworks.internal
JOROX_SEAL=seal_c78f63c1
JOROX_STANDBY_TEAM=norax

The sidecar authenticates to the aggregation tier using a short-lived token minted at pod startup. If the token service at Hollowmere is unreachable for more than fifteen minutes, the sidecar enters a sealed state and stops forwarding metrics. Recovery requires an operator to re-seed the trust store manually; this action is audited and requires two-person approval. For that procedure, the operator must supply the recovery passphrase recorded immediately below this entry.

vault phrase of tajop-haduf = holath-brivan-wenax

- [ ] Step 7: Archive cold storage buckets (Glacierline tier). Confirm both ceremony witnesses are present, verify bucket manifests match the Oxbow ledger, then seal the archive key shares. Plugin authors may observe but not handle shares. Once sealed, the archive index itself is encrypted and can only be reopened with the passphrase below.

vault phrase of badup-hahig = tamael-aldael-kelmir-istael-fenok-istwyn-tamius-jorath-oliion